Ticket: PANTRYMATH-412 — Signature verification failed on the v2.3.1 release of the PantryMath recipe-scaling calculator. The CI job at Orchardline rejected the artifact because the manifest was re-signed after a last-minute fix to the fraction-rounding module, but the old public key remained in the verifier config. Future maintainers: always regenerate the manifest before signing, and confirm the verifier bundle matches the keyring revision noted in the release notes. To unblock the pipeline, re-sign the artifact using the key below.

release key, fahaf-bajof: bky3_Xam

Ticket: Unlock migration vault for Ironvine ORM refactor

New team members: the legacy Ironvine ORM layer is being replaced module by module, and the schema snapshots needed for safe refactoring sit in a locked vault nobody has opened since the last owner left. We recovered the credentials from escrow this week. The passphrase follows below.

unlock words, kajog-yawip: istwyn-casath-aldok

This runbook covers vendoring third-party fonts into the Quillbarrow build pipeline. First, confirm the font license allows redistribution and record it in the manifest. Convert each family to woff2 using the fontpress tool, then upload the artifacts to our internal asset vault, Glyphhold. Do not commit binaries directly to the repo; the vault is the source of truth. Uploads to Glyphhold require authentication, and the service key for the vendoring pipeline is provided below.

gateway credential: kto3_qfe

Visiting contractors at Lundqvist Dynamics may access the spare-hardware storage room on Level 2 only when escorted by a facilities team member. All removed items must be logged at the desk before departure, and the door must be confirmed latched on exit. Entry requires the pass code below.

staff pass of kawep-hahap = bdg-IEUUF-6

This alert fires when the average compression ratio drops below 2.1 over a fifteen-minute window, which usually indicates agents sending pre-compressed or malformed payloads, or a codec mismatch after an agent rollout. Left unaddressed, storage costs climb and downstream batch jobs slow. Check recent agent deploys first, then inspect the codec negotiation logs on the ingest nodes. Triage steps and rollback guidance are documented at the page below.

dashboard of yafog-fajof = https://jira.tolvaqsys.internal/pages/pages/projects/49fe21c4